在本地连接并创建oracle数据库服务器需要以下步骤:1)从oracle官方网站下载适合操作系统的软件并安装,设置全局数据库名称和sid;2)使用sqlplus运行create database脚本创建数据库;3)安装完成后,使用sqlplus或其他客户端工具连接数据库。通过这些步骤,你可以在本地环境中成功设置和管理oracle数据库。
要在本地连接并创建Oracle数据库服务器,首先需要理解Oracle数据库的基本结构和安装过程。Oracle数据库是一个强大的关系数据库管理系统(RDBMS),广泛应用于企业级应用中。通过本文,你将学会如何在本地环境中设置Oracle数据库服务器,并进行基本的连接和数据库创建操作。
在开始之前,了解一些基本概念是必要的。Oracle数据库由多个组件组成,包括数据库实例(Instance)、数据库(Database)、表空间(Tablespace)、数据文件(Datafile)等。Oracle数据库实例是数据库引擎的运行环境,而数据库则是数据存储的集合。
接下来,让我们来探讨如何在本地安装并连接Oracle数据库服务器。首先,你需要从Oracle官方网站下载适合你操作系统的Oracle数据库软件。安装过程中,你将被要求设置一些基本参数,如全局数据库名称(Global Database Name)和SID(System Identifier)。
-- 创建数据库 CREATE DATABASE mydatabase USER SYS IDENTIFIED BY sys_password USER SYSTEM IDENTIFIED BY system_password LOGFILE GROUP 1 ('/u01/oradata/mydatabase/redo01.log') SIZE 100M, GROUP 2 ('/u01/oradata/mydatabase/redo02.log') SIZE 100M, GROUP 3 ('/u01/oradata/mydatabase/redo03.log') SIZE 100M MAXLOGFILES 16 MAXLOGMEMBERS 3 MAXDATAFILES 100 CHARACTER SET AL32UTF8 NATIONAL CHARACTER SET AL16UTF16 EXTENT MANAGEMENT LOCAL DATAFILE '/u01/oradata/mydatabase/system01.dbf' SIZE 700M REUSE SYSAUX DATAFILE '/u01/oradata/mydatabase/sysaux01.dbf' SIZE 500M REUSE DEFAULT TABLESPACE users DATAFILE '/u01/oradata/mydatabase/users01.dbf' SIZE 500M REUSE AUTOEXTEND ON MAXSIZE UNLIMITED DEFAULT TEMPORARY TABLESPACE temp TEMPFILE '/u01/oradata/mydatabase/temp01.dbf' SIZE 200M REUSE UNDO TABLESPACE undo DATAFILE '/u01/oradata/mydatabase/undo01.dbf' SIZE 200M REUSE AUTOEXTEND ON MAXSIZE UNLIMITED;
上面的SQL脚本展示了如何创建一个名为mydatabase的数据库。注意,这段代码需要在Oracle的SQLPlus环境中运行。安装完成后,你可以使用SQLPlus或其他Oracle客户端工具连接到数据库。
在实际操作中,你可能会遇到一些常见的问题,比如权限不足、端口冲突等。解决这些问题的一个有效方法是仔细检查Oracle安装日志,确保所有服务都正确启动。另外,Oracle的文档和社区资源非常丰富,可以帮助你解决大部分问题。
在性能优化方面,Oracle数据库提供了许多工具和技术,如索引优化、分区表、物化视图等。这些技术可以显著提高查询性能和系统的整体效率。根据我的经验,在设计数据库架构时,提前考虑这些优化策略可以避免后期的性能瓶颈。
总之,设置和连接本地Oracle数据库服务器需要一定的技术知识和耐心。通过本文的指导,你应该能够在本地环境中成功安装和管理Oracle数据库。如果你在过程中遇到任何问题,不妨多查阅Oracle的官方文档,或者在技术社区中寻求帮助。